Air Reserve Technicians are full-time civilian employees who are also members of the Air Force Reserve unit in which they are employed. In addition to their civilian assignments, they are assigned to equivalent positions in the Reserve organization with a Reserve military rank or grade.

Appointee's civilian assignments will consist of the following duties.

The primary purpose of this position is: to provide clinical oversight in the management and execution of nursing care competencies, organizational training, and flying training requirements supporting the aeromedical evacuation (AE) mission within an Aeromedical Evacuation Squadron. Duty 1: Performs nursing care in the aeromedical environment. Functions as senior medical member of AE crew in performance of aeromedical evacuation missions.

Duty 2: Oversees AE training programs to ensure assigned personnel are adequately trained in specialty and mission requirements. Duty 3: Plans, develops, and administers specialized aircrew training program for aeromedical aircrew members. Duty 4: Represents the nursing and aircrew functions to external agencies such as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A), Veterans Affairs (VA), state and local emergency management officials along with wing and HQ functional representatives; establishes, develops, and maintains effective working relationships to further organizational goals.
